RCA:
From declaration of glusterd_volinfo_ struct:
int subvol_count; /* Number of subvolumes in a
distribute volume */
int dist_leaf_count; /* Number of bricks in one
distribute subvolume */
glusterd_add_volume_detail_to_dict() is adding dist_leaf_count into the dict instead of subvol_count.
keylen = snprintf(key, sizeof(key), "volume%d.dist_count", count);
ret = dict_set_int32n(volumes, key, keylen, volinfo->dist_leaf_count); <-- this is leading to wrong distCount value in vol info --xml output.
if (ret)
goto out;
